Richie Sambora Says Bon Jovi Issues Yet To Be Resolved

Bon Jovi guitarist Richie Sambora has posted a tweet stating that he issues with Jon Bon Jovi are far from being resolved at this stage.

Sambora posted, “Hey everybody, there’s nothing I can say right now cause nothing is resolved. I thank you all for your loyalty and concern…”

Earlier this week after speculation that Sambora left Bon Jovi to start a clothing line he wrote, “Just to be clear, I’ve been running the fashion company for 5 Yrs. It does not take me away from the band, I’m an artist first. Always will be.”

His post prior to that was, “Just don’t worry… Everything’s good….”

Richie Sambora has been missing in action from Bon Jovi since April 3 this year. Bon Jovi have gone ahead with the Because We Can tour with Phil X (Xenidis) filling in for Sambora. Sambora is still officially a member of Bon Jovi and is still be used in all advertising material for the current tour.

The next Bon Jovi show will be tonight (May 26) in Tampere, Finland.

Bon Jovi will tour Australia in December for Paul Dainty.
